QUOTE(owikh84 @ Oct 18 2017, 11:06 AM) What Prime95 version are you using? im using same prime95 at 7700k a few second temp rise to 100c v26.6 and below have no AVX/FMA3 instruction v27.9 has less stressful AVX, no FMA3 v28.5 and newer has stressful AVX+FMA3 Edit: I can see FMA3 in your SS so should be one of the latest versions. Your CPU core temps look great. |
